How to Access Hospice
Programs & Services
Hospice welcomes
self-referrals. If you or someone you love is living
with a life-threatening illness, call Hospice at 632-5593– we
can help. Referrals to Hospice can also be made by your family
physician, your medical specialist, nurses, social workers, clergy and
Extra-Mural.
When You Call Us
When you call Hospice, you will be
directed to one of our two program coordinators. They are responsible
for assessing your needs, coordinating the delivery of our services,
supervising volunteers and serving as a supportive and empathetic
resource.
Our program coordinator will ask you
for your name, address and phone number as well as the name of your
family or attending physician. You will also be asked for general
medical condition, diagnosis and prognosis. Our program coordinator
will arrange a date and time to visit you to introduce herself, to
discuss your needs, review Hospice services and give you a complete
information package. Our program coordinators will also notify your
family or attending physician that you have requested our services.
